Please click here to learn more about our locations.**Job Description**Collaboration 15%Collaboration Work collaboratively with project stakeholders to develop a comprehensive project plan including: Scope, Schedule, Budget, Communications, Staffing, Risk and Issue Management, Test, and Change Management. Perform Change Management 10%Perform Change Management Create and manage project Change Requests and implement approved requests to achieve project deliverables. Perform Communication Management 10%Perform Communication Management Create / implement project organization and communication plans which enable the project team to effectively work together to meet project objectives. Communicate accurate, timely status information to the PMO and stakeholders. Perform Issue & Risk Management 10%Perform Issue & Risk Management Create RAIDC logs (Risk, Action, Issue, Decision, Changes). Efficiently identify and solve project issues as they arise. Perform Meeting Management 10%Perform Meeting Management Prepare meeting agendas and meeting minutes, schedule and lead regularly recurring status meetings, distribute meeting documentation, and maintain and monitor action item listings as necessary. Facilitate and lead meetings and steering committee meetings by being well-prepared and adhering to topics. 20%Perform Project Management Create and execute project work plans in accordance with the Project Definition Document and revise as appropriate to meet changing needs and requirements. Manage projects through the lifecycle stages. Constantly monitor and report on progress of the project to all stakeholders as needed. Meet with customers and internal stake holders to effectively communicate project expectations in a timely and clear manner. Successfully deliver projects on time, on budget and within project scope. Assist in driving project management governance, methods, methodologies, and tool acceptance. Perform Project Planning 15%Perform Project Planning Create / build / update project schedules, project definition documents, project plans, status reports, and work breakdown structures. Perform Project Scope Management 10%Perform Project Scope Management Effectively manage project work within the stated scope.The pay range for this position is $107,702.40 - $161,574.40. Compensation is determined based on years of relevant experience and departmental equity.
